Young African Lady whose lecturer said she will not make it to US university defeats prophesy, bags Masters degree

Elizabeth Laiza Kalu, a young woman from Africa, has defied the prediction of one of her college professors who declared she would not succeed in attending a university in the United States of America (USA).

Elizabeth Laiza Kalu, who recently earned a master’s degree from New York University (NYU), New York, USA, recalled how one of her professors at Suffolk University in Boston, Massachusetts, predicted that she would never be accepted to a prestigious university like NYU or Columbia University when she was a student there.

She had requested a recommendation letter from her lecturer, but was informed she would never be accepted to the institution. Elizabeth received her Master’s in Public Administration from New York University (NYU) a few years after the instructor made the remark.

Elizabeth posted about her accomplishment on social media, noting that she was aware that her lecturer was projecting her own fears onto her and that she hadn’t anticipated a young black girl to have such aspirations.

“Now I clearly understand that she was projecting her own insecurities on me and she didn’t expect a young black girl to have such ambitions. Thankfully, I know my identity in Christ is bigger than any degree and I’m fully backed by a God that can be trusted,” Elizabeth said.
